Report spotlights Sir Fred’s escorts

IF the Queen’s Representative, Sir Frederick Goodwin, doesn’t drive around with two Police motorcyclists escorting his car in future, here’s why.
The report on the Police review has recommended guidelines be drawn up. Police escorts should only be deployed for VIP movement specified by the guidelines, it recommends.
The report looks at how the current four Police marked motorcycles are used and their need to be used for traffic laws enforcement.
It says: “Traffic staff provide personal escort services for VIPs.
“This is principally the Queen’s Representative and the Prime Minister.
“On those occasions when a Police escort is requested, two officers are committed for the duration of that exercise.
“The current Prime Minister reportedly uses this service sparingly, however the Queen’s Representative likes to use an escort whenever he is travelling on official business.”
The report recommends: “That guidelines for VIP escorts for the Queen’s Representative, Prime Minister and other dignitaries be drawn up and agreed by all parties. Escorts only to deploy for VIP movements specified by the guidelines.”
The report also says the vehicles for traffic enforcement are substandard.
It says:
n the four motorcycles used by the traffic group were operating at the time of the review visit but staff indicated their general mechanical worthiness was fragile;
n the two ‘Police’ marked vehicles on Rarotonga were substandard, with secondhand light bars that did not work on one and worked intermittently on the other.
The radar speed unit could not be used from one of these, it said.
The report says traffic enforcement on Rarotonga needs to be bolstered. “VIP escort duties should be considered as additional to the traffic enforcement effort,” it adds.
